Six Falcons earn All-Region honors

WALTHAM, Mass. – Six players from Bentley baseball earned All-Region honors as the team prepares to play in its first ever Division II College World Series.

The organizations announcing its All-Region teams were the American Baseball Coaches Association (ABCA), the National Collegiate Baseball Writers Association (NCBWA) and the Division 2 Conference Commissioners Association (D2CCA).

 
Nick Pappas (Graduate Student | Outfielder)
Pappas was voted first team All-Region by all three organizations and last week was announced as a third team All-America by the NCBWA.

He leads the team with a .399 batting average and in game two of the Super Regional against Molloy, became the first player in program history to surpass 100 hits in a single season.

The Boston, Mass., native has 12 homers, 61 RBI and leads the team with a .463 on-base percentage.


Stan DeMartinis III (Graduate Student | DH)
The cleanup hitter in the Falcons' devastating lineup, DeMartinis III received first team honors from all three organizations.

He broke the program record for both single-season and career home runs on May 1 and comes into the World Series with 23 long balls on the season to rank fifth in Division II. He leads the team in slugging percentage (.675) and is second in RBI (77).

He launched two homers in Bentley's game two win over Wilmington in the East Regional to help force the decisive game three.

 
Jared Berardino (Graduate Student | Outfielder)
Berardino was named to the ABCA's first team and the NCBWA's and D2CCA's second team.

He has a .373 batting average with 19 home runs and 59 RBI heading into the World Series. He leads the squad with a 1.131 OPS.

In Bentley's 10 postseason games so far, he leads the team with a .390 average and has mashed four homers.


Pat Heber (Senior | Pitcher)
Heber has starred on the mound for the Falcons and was named first team by both the ABCA and D2CCA and second team by the NCBWA.

The lefty from Garden City, N.Y., is 10-0 on the season with a 3.70 ERA and 93 strikeouts. He's been a workhorse with a team leading 90 innings pitched.

In the postseason he is 3-0 with a 1.66 ERA and 21 strikeouts in 21.2 innings pitched. He tossed eight shutout innings in Bentley's game one Super Regional victory over Molloy.

 
Brendan Sencaj (Junior | Utility)
Sencaj was selected first team All-Region by the NCBWA and D2CCA and to the ABCA's second team.

He's batting .353 with 17 homers and a team best 80 RBI. He's second on the team with a 1.106 OPS. Sencaj has also been stellar in the field between centerfield and first base with a .985 fielding percentage.

In the game three Super Regional victory over Molloy, he blasted a clutch solo home run in the sixth inning to tie the game 1-1.

 
Curt Heath (Sophomore | Second Baseman)
Heath garnered second team All-Region honors from the ABCA and D2CCA.

Entering the World Series, Heath is second on the Falcons with a .375 batting average. He's fourth in hits (78) and on-base percentage (.456).

In the 10 postseason games he's hitting .344.
